#2eb33d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2eb33d is composed of 18% red, 70.2%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.9%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 126.8 degrees, a saturation of 59.1% and a lightness of 44.1%. #2eb33d color hex could be obtained by blending #5cff7a with #006700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#2eb33d color description : Moderate lime green.
#2eb33d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2eb33d has RGB values of R:46, G:179,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 3060541.
